Q: Photosynthesis is the putting together of carbohydrates by using light energy?

The process in which autotrophs use light energy to make carbohydrates is called what?

The process in which autotrophs use light energy to make carbohydrates is called photosynthesis. Chemosynthesis is the process by which some organisms use chemical energy to produce carbohydrates.

How getting carbohydrates energy?

The energy contained in most carbohydrate molecules ultimately originates from photosynthesis in plants. Most carbohydrates thus get their energy from the sun.
